体育锻炼和间歇性服用乳果糖可能通过产氢改善自闭症症状。

Physical exercise and intermittent administration of lactulose may improve autism symptoms through hydrogen production.

作者信息

Ghanizadeh Ahmad

机构信息

Research Center for Psychiatry and Behavioral Sciences, Department of Psychiatry, School of Medicine, Shiraz University of Medical Sciences, Shiraz, Iran.

出版信息

Med Gas Res. 2012 Jul 30;2(1):19. doi: 10.1186/2045-9912-2-19.

DOI:10.1186/2045-9912-2-19
PMID:22846252
原文链接:https://pmc.ncbi.nlm.nih.gov/articles/PMC3464164/
Abstract

Autism is neuro-developmental disorder. Oxidative stress is enhanced in some children with autism. Hydrogen is a gas with anti-oxidative effects suggested for treating or prevention of some medical problems. It is hypothesized that lactulose or hydrogen water may provide hydrogen to reduce oxidative stress in autism.
